  • The Holocaust Educational Trust’s Outreach Programme

    Published 02/10/23

    Guilsborough Academy were delighted to take part in the Holocaust Educational Trust’s Outreach Programme on Thursday 28th September with the delivery of a second-generation holocaust survivor's testimony to our Year 10 students.

  • Information Evenings

    Published 13/09/23

     

     

     

     

     

     

    Information Evenings – September 2023

    Information Evenings  will set out our vision and expectations for the year ahead. These will take place this month and will start at 6.30 pm. The dates for each year group are as follows:

    • Year 7 – 12th September, 6.30pm-7.30pm
    • Year 8 – 13th September, 6.30pm-7.30pm
    • Year 11 – 14th September, 6.30pm-7.30pm
    • Year 10 – 19th September, 6.30pm-7.30pm
    • Year 9 – 20th September, 6.30pm-7.30pm

    There will be several presentations during the evening focussing on the following areas:

    • A welcome by the Principal
    • An introduction to The Guilsborough Way
    • What pastoral support is available for your child
    • The Curriculum, Assessments and Events for the year ahead
    • How you can use Go 4 schools for homework, reports, attendance, rewards and pin numbers for the canteen
    • How we approach inclusion and wellbeing
    • Enrichment at Guilsborough Academy

    This is a Parent Information evening so we do ask where possible to not bring your child as numbers are limited. If you wish to attend could you please complete the form where you can also submit a  question that you would like answering on the evening.

  • SUPPORT FOR YOUNG PEOPLE & PARENTS DURING THE SUMMER HOLIDAYS

    Published 17/07/23
    The Lowdown The Lowdown offers free and Confidential Counselling, Wellbeing Support, LGBTQ+ Support, Practical Support and Sexual Health Services for 11–25-year-olds and their families. Address: 3 Kingswell Street, Northampton NN1 1PP
